5624ecc65e Remove the 'X-Forwarded-Proto' line from the nginx config
The reason is that in the default configuration nginx is only serving 'http' traffic.
So if an upstream proxy sets the 'X-Forwarded-Proto' header, because it is terminating
TLS, then nginx will overwrite it to 'http'. This will cause django to think the page
is served via 'http' and it will not create 'https://...' URLs.

a217ce8ffd Changed "build-branches.sh" to "build-next.sh"
The old version of "build-branches.sh" skipped the pushing of images when one of
them didn't change its sources. When looking at the Netbox branches I noticed
that the "master" branch only changes when there is a new release. Because we
build the new releases anyway in "build-latest.sh" that leaves "develop" and
"develop-*" which change regularly. The new script "build-next.sh" is responsible
for building "develop-*" as the next major release of Netbox. The build of
"develop" is moved to the Github Action build matrix. This has the additional
advantage of being faster because more builds are done in parallel.

20109c3392 Checkout the repository with git
This changes the build process even further. Instead
f using `wget` to fetch the current code, `git` is used.
This allows for faster switching between branches,
because only the differences between them have to be
fetched from the server.

But the main advantage is that the build cache can
finally be used as designed by Docker. Repetitive
builds are very fast now. This is also true between
branches and tags, as long as the `requirements.txt`
file doesn't change.

013f81b791 ♻️ Make netbox-worker it's own container
One container should ideally have one responsibility [1]. Therefore I
implemented the netbox-worker to start in it's own container. This is
possible, because netbox and the worker communicate via redis anyway.

They still use the same image underneath, just the "command" they
execute while starting different.

Or in other words: I see no reason to introduce supervisord, when we
already have docker-compose which can take care of running multiple
processes.

Also, here's another benefit: Now it's possible to view the logs of the
webhook worker independently of the other netbox logs (and vice-versa).

### Running on Docker Swarm / Kubernetes / OpenShift
You may run this image in a cluster such as Docker Swarm, Kubernetes or OpenShift, but this is advanced level.
In this case, we encourage you to statically configure NetBox by starting from [NetBox's example config file][default-config], and mounting it into your container in the directory `/etc/netbox/config/` using the mechanism provided by your container platform (i.e. [Docker Swarm configs][swarm-config], [Kubernetes ConfigMap][k8s-config], [OpenShift ConfigMaps][openshift-config]).
But if you rather continue to configure your application through environment variables, you may continue to use [the built-in configuration file][docker-config].
We discourage storing secrets in environment variables, as environment variable are passed on to all sub-processes and may leak easily into other systems, e.g. error collecting tools that often collect all environment variables whenever an error occurs.
Therefore we *strongly advise* to make use of the secrets mechanism provided by your container platform (i.e. [Docker Swarm secrets][swarm-secrets], [Kubernetes secrets][k8s-secrets], [OpenShift secrets][openshift-secrets]).
[The configuration file][docker-config] and [the entrypoint script][entrypoint] try to load the following secrets from the respective files.
If a secret is defined by an environment variable and in the respective file at the same time, then the value from the environment variable is used.
* `SUPERUSER_PASSWORD`: `/run/secrets/superuser_password`
* `SUPERUSER_API_TOKEN`: `/run/secrets/superuser_api_token`
* `DB_PASSWORD`: `/run/secrets/db_password`
* `SECRET_KEY`: `/run/secrets/secret_key`
* `EMAIL_PASSWORD`: `/run/secrets/email_password`
* `NAPALM_PASSWORD`: `/run/secrets/napalm_password`

### Custom Initialization Code (e.g. Automatically Setting Up Custom Fields)
When using `docker-compose`, all the python scripts present in `/opt/netbox/startup_scripts` will automatically be executed after the application boots in the context of `./manage.py`.
That mechanism can be used for many things, e.g. to create NetBox custom fields:
```python
# docker/startup_scripts/load_custom_fields.py
from django.contrib.contenttypes.models import ContentType
from extras.models import CF_TYPE_TEXT, CustomField
from dcim.models import Device
from dcim.models import DeviceType
device = ContentType.objects.get_for_model(Device)
device_type = ContentType.objects.get_for_model(DeviceType)
my_custom_field, created = CustomField.objects.get_or_create(
type=CF_TYPE_TEXT,
name='my_custom_field',
description='My own custom field'
)
if created:
my_custom_field.obj_type.add(device)
my_custom_field.obj_type.add(device_type)
```
